Oligomycin A (MCH 32) is a modulator linked to Apoptosis and related pathway-oriented research. It is especially relevant in apoptosis, cancer, and infectious disease models, where defined compound exposure can be linked to caspase-associated cell-death signaling and survival decisions.

The pathway annotation connects Oligomycin A (MCH 32) to Apoptosis, supporting experiments that monitor caspase-associated cell-death signaling and survival decisions across biochemical, cellular, or phenotypic assay formats. This context is compatible with apoptosis, viability, and caspase-readout assays, as well as transcriptional, biochemical, or phenotypic comparisons linked to the annotated pathway state. In apoptosis, cancer, and infectious disease models, these readouts can be combined with viability, reporter, localization, biochemical conversion, or morphology endpoints to refine experimental interpretation.

CAS No.:
579-13-5
Molecular Weight:
791.06
Formula:
C₄₅H₇₄O₁₁
SMILES:
CCC1CCC2C(C(C(C3(O2)CCC(C(O3)CC(C)O)C)C)OC(=O)C=CC(C(C(C(=O)C(C(C(C(=O)C(C(C(CC=CC=C1)C)O)(C)O)C)O)C)C)O)C)C
Storage Temperature:
-20°C
